Early Life

Tilly’s real name is Jennifer Ellen Chan, and she was born in Harbor City, California. She is the eldest child of Canadian educator and former stage actress Patricia Chan and American-born used-car salesman Harry Chan. Her mother was of Irish and Finnish origin, and her father was of Chinese descent. She is one of three siblings; Steve is her eldest sibling and Meg and Rebecca are her younger ones.

Tilly was reared by her mother and stepfather, John Ward, on rural Texada Island in British Columbia after her parents divorced when she was five. Ward’s sister Meg claims that her sibling was a vicious pedophile. While Jennifer’s sister Becky shared the same opinion, she herself remained silent. When Tilly was 16 years old, her mother got a second divorce. When Tilly was in secondary school, her family relocated to the British Columbian town of Langford, where she attended Belmont. Tilly graduated from Stephens College in Missouri with a BA in drama.

Career

In 1983, Tilly starred on “Oh Madeline” and “Boone” as a guest star; in 1984, she became a regular cast member on “Hill Street Blues” and had her film debut in “No Small Affair.” Jennifer made 11 film and television appearances in the 1980s, including “Remington Steele”, “Cheers”, “It’s Garry Shandling’s Show”, and “Moonlighting”, and the roles in “Johnny Be Good”, “Let It Ride”  and “The Fabulous Baker Boys”.

After that, she starred in 1993’s “Made in America” and 1995’s “The Getaway,” and in 1994’s “Bullets over Broadway,” she was nominated for an Oscar for her portrayal of Olive Neal. Tilly also made appearances in the television movies “At Home with the Webbers” and “Heads” during this time, in addition to starring on the Fox series “Key West”.

Jennifer’s 1996 film “Bound” received a GLAAD Media Award for Outstanding Film, and her 1997 film “Liar Liar,” in which she co-starred with Jim Carrey, made $302.7 million worldwide.

Starting with 1998’s “Bride of Chucky,” Tilly has portrayed Tiffany Valentine in the “Child’s Play” film series. She also had roles in the films “Seed of Chucky”, “Curse of Chucky”, and “Cult of Chucky”. She voiced Celie Mae in “Monsters, Inc.,” which earned $577.4 million at the box office, and appeared as Crystal Allen in “The Women” on Broadway the same year.

Jennifer debuted on the CBS sitcom “Out of Practice” from 2005 to 2006, and she has since acted in “Bart Got a Room” , “Inconceivable”, and the Chinese film “Empire of Silver”.

She has a guest starring roles on “Modern Family” in 2011 and 2014, and she was a guest judge on “RuPaul’s Drag Race” in 2012. In 2012, Tilly had another Broadway appearance with “Don’t Dress for Dinner,” for which she was nominated for an Audience Choice Award; the following year, she starred in “Grasses of a Thousand Colors” at the Joseph Papp Theater.

Jennifer’s latest credits include roles in “7 Days to Vegas” and “Poker Queens”, as well as the vocal role of Little Red Riding Hood in an episode of “JJ Villard’s Fairy Tales”. In 2021, she will have roles in the films Sallywood, High Holiday, and Boom.

Personal Life

From 1984 until 1991, Tilly was married to Sam Simon, creator, and producer of The Simpsons. As of the 2018 fiscal year, 30% of the net proceeds that Simon’s estate earns from Fox are sent to Tilly. Since 2004, she has been with Phil Laak, a professional poker player.

Net Worth

American actress and poker player Jennifer Tilly have a $25 million fortune According to celebrity net worth. Tilly, who has been nominated for an Oscar and has more than 120 acting credits to her record, got her start in the 1994 Woody Allen picture “Bullets Over Broadway.”

Jennifer has since captivated viewers in films like 1996’s “Bound,” 1996’s “House Arrest,” 1997’s “Liar, Liar,” and 2005’s “The Haunted Mansion”. The voice of Bonnie Swanson on the Fox cartoon comedy “Family Guy” since 1999, Tilly is arguably best known for her role as Tiffany Valentine in the “Child’s Play” horror franchise.

She voiced Celia Mae in Disney’s “Monsters, Inc.” and is set to reprise the role in the upcoming 2021 Disney+ series “Monsters at Work.” Jennifer’s voice can also be heard in “Hey Arnold!”, “The Simpsons”, and “SuperMansion,” as well as the films “Stuart Little” and “Home on the Range”.

In 2004, at the urging of her professional poker player boyfriend Phil “Unabomber” Laak, Tilly began competing in poker tournaments; the following year, she won the World Series’ Ladies World Poker Championship and the World Poker Ladies Night III.
